Recalled Panel Replacement

Federal Pacific Electric, Zinsco, Sylvania, Challenger, and Pushmatic panels have documented safety failure modes that make them candidates for replacement in any Cedar Heights home where they remain in service. We assess the specific condition of recalled panels before recommending replacement — presenting the documented failure modes clearly so you can make an informed decision — and replace with modern, code-compliant alternatives where replacement is the appropriate conclusion.

AFCI & GFCI Breaker Upgrades

Modern electrical code in Cedar Heights, MD requires AFCI protection in most living areas — arc fault circuit interrupters that detect the electrical arcing that most commonly leads to residential fires. Older panels may lack this protection entirely. We upgrade panels with AFCI and GFCI breakers where code requires them, providing meaningful, lasting safety improvement at targeted cost.

Common Panel Issues in Cedar Heights

Breakers Tripping Under Normal Household Demand

Chronic breaker trips indicate either an overloaded circuit, a failing breaker, or a wiring fault. We identify which is occurring — the repair is different for each, and guessing wrong wastes money without resolving the problem.

A Panel That's Full With No Space for New Circuits

Solutions include a subpanel addition, tandem breakers where the panel supports them, or a full panel replacement with a larger enclosure. We assess which is technically appropriate and most cost-effective for your specific Cedar Heights, MD installation.

A Panel Running Warm Under Normal Household Load

External warmth on a panel enclosure indicates internal heat generation — from overloaded breakers, a loose bus bar connection, or a main connection fault. This requires professional assessment in Cedar Heights, not monitoring.

📝 Blog: When Is the Right Time to Upgrade Your Electrical Panel in Cedar Heights?

The right time to upgrade an electrical panel is before you need to — but the challenge is identifying that moment accurately. Upgrading too early wastes money. Waiting until failure is reactive and expensive. The answer lies in understanding the indicators that reliably predict when a panel is approaching the limits of what it can safely support.

The first indicator is consistent breaker trips on circuits that haven't changed. A breaker that trips under a load it's handled for years without incident is either failing — becoming less able to hold its rated current — or the circuit load has crept upward as appliances were replaced with higher-draw alternatives. Either condition warrants assessment.

The second is approaching full panel capacity. A panel with two or three open slots in Cedar Heights, MD is a panel that can't support significant future additions without modification. If you're planning an EV charger, a home addition, a major kitchen upgrade, or any project that requires new circuits — the panel should be assessed for capacity before the project begins, not during it.

The third is age combined with condition. Panels over 30 years old in Cedar Heights aren't automatically candidates for replacement, but they warrant careful inspection. Connection quality degrades, bus bar corrosion accumulates, and breaker reliability decreases with age in ways that aren't visible from the outside. A professional panel condition assessment at the 30-year mark gives you accurate information rather than assumptions.
